转换TreeSet以填充HashMap的最佳方法是什么?

时间:2014-07-10 16:57:47

标签: java hashmap treeset

使用Java转换TreeSet以填充HashMap的最佳方法是什么? 例如:

SortedSet<Map.Entry<String, Double>> sortedset =
  new TreeSet<Map.Entry<String, Double>();

Map<String, Double> map = new HashMap<String, Double>();

1 个答案:

答案 0 :(得分:4)

我可能错了,但我不认为Java有任何内置的功能。你最好的选择是手动完成(这非常简单):

for (Map.Entry<String, Double> entry : sortedSet)
    map.put(entry.getKey(), entry.getValue());